WebJun 4, 2010 · 4.11.3. Managing Metastability. Metastability problems can occur in digital design when a signal is transferred between circuitry in unrelated or asynchronous clock domains, because the designer cannot guarantee that the signal meets the setup and hold time requirements during the signal transfer. A multi-flop … great rhosWebMultiple Clocks. Another area you can run into metastability issues is crossing clock domains. This is when your design has multiple clocks of different frequencies. You can’t simply connect the output of a DFF being clocked at 33MHz to one being clocked at 100MHz. There will be times when timing is violated and bad things happen. flopped straightWebJan 29, 2024 · Let’s confine to the metastability occurring in synchronous circuits in this article.
